bpf: Exit early if reg_bounds_sync gets invalid inputs
In the subsequent commit, to prune dead branches we will rely on detecting ill-formed ranges using range_bounds_violations() (e.g., umin > umax) after refining register bounds using regs_refine_cond_op(). However, reg_bounds_sync() can sometimes "repair" ill-formed bounds, potentially masking a violation that was produced by regs_refine_cond_op(). This commit modifies reg_bounds_sync() to exit early if an invariant violation is already present in the input. This ensures ill-formed reg_states remain ill-formed after reg_bounds_sync(), allowing simulate_both_branches_taken() to correctly identify dead branches with a single check to range_bounds_violation().
